In 1918, as World War One swept across Europe, a silent and deadly enemy overtook the entire world. The Spanish Flu Pandemic resulted in the death of between 50 to 100 million people yet it is largely forgotten today. This exhibit explores this catastrophic event and how it impacted the people of Kings County.
